Output 0968c35b10510b712ce75df35cb199a9952985371b4f6c45bfe954ffa1dd2270:66

value
2894429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c407377d6154fec72674173611e7bbc6ef4a71b OP_EQUAL
address
37BbgC2HLZeWPcR9jnKiPTiSGyT1DL5Vxw
transaction
0968c35b10510b712ce75df35cb199a9952985371b4f6c45bfe954ffa1dd2270
spent
true